准噶尔盆地陆东—五彩湾地区石炭系中、基性火山岩地球化学及其形成环境

摘    要:准噶尔盆地是发育在前寒武纪结晶基底与古生代褶皱基底双重基底之上的中、新生代沉积盆地。盆地东北缘陆东—五彩湾地区发育大量的石炭系中、基性火山岩,主要由玄武岩、熔结玄武岩、气孔-杏仁玄武岩与辉绿岩组成。其中、基性火山岩具有低钾高钛、高∑REE的特征,球粒陨石标准化的REE配分曲线表现轻稀土富集,轻、重稀土分异的谱线特征,微量元素具有大离子亲石元素富集,Ta、Nb亏损的现象,可能与板内拉张环境下地壳混染或地幔源区有富Ta、Nb的残留体有关,微量元素环境判别图解中大部分样品点落入板内玄武岩区域,少量漂向岛弧火山岩区,表现出主体为板内构造环境;高场强元素Th/Nb、Nb/Zr比值进一步表现出火山岩具有板内火山岩的特征。综合区域地质特征及前人的研究结果,认为准噶尔盆地陆东—五彩湾地区中、基性火山岩应属造山期后伸展背景下的火山作用产物,但岩浆源区可能受到古洋壳板片俯冲作用的影响。

Geochemistry and tectonic settings of Carboniferous intermediate-basic volcanic rocks in Ludong-Wucaiwan, Junggar basin

Abstract:The basement of the Junggar basin is a part of Kazakhstan plate,and is interspersed in the Tarim plate and the Siberia plate.The Ludong-Wucaiwan area,located on the northeast of the basin,has a lot of Carboniferous neutral-basic volcanic rocks,which is the key to the research on the Carboniferous tectonic setting of the Junggar basin.The volcanic rocks are mainly composed of basalt,sintered basalt,andesite-basalt,amygdaloidal basalt and diabase.The geochemistry shows the characteristics of low K,higher Ti and high ∑REE.The trace element compositions of different volcanic rocks are all rich in LREE without obvious Eu anomaly,LILE are rich in the basalt,Nb and Ta relative to La are depleted strongly.This type of volcanic rocks shows not only the signature of within-plate setting,but also that of a subduction zone.The geochemical characteristics are similar to some characteristics of "lagged arc volcanic rocks".Combining with the regional geological data and previous research findings,we conclude that the Carboniferous basic volcanic rocks of the study area were generated in an extensional setting of the late stage of orogenesis,but the magma source may have been influenced by the earlier oceanic plate subduction.
